Russian ‘Spy’ Bailed in India

An Indian court agreed Tuesday to release on bail Olga Timoshik, a Russian citizen detained in June for visa violations but accused by Indian authorities of working as a spy, Interfax reported, citing her lawyer, Birinder Singh.

Timoshik is expected to be released on Thursday or Friday, Singh said, adding that the bail was not set Tuesday.

An investigation is ongoing, and an Indian police official told RIA-Novosti on Monday that charges against Timoshik might be filed within a month.
